52 typedef enum {
53 M64ERR_SUCCESS = 0,
54 M64ERR_NOT_INIT, /* Function is disallowed before InitMupen64Plus() is called */
55 M64ERR_ALREADY_INIT, /* InitMupen64Plus() was called twice */
56 M64ERR_INCOMPATIBLE, /* API versions between components are incompatible */
57 M64ERR_INPUT_ASSERT, /* Invalid parameters for function call, such as ParamValue=NULL for GetCoreParameter() */
58 M64ERR_INPUT_INVALID, /* Invalid input data, such as ParamValue="maybe" for SetCoreParameter() to set a BOOL-type value */
59 M64ERR_INPUT_NOT_FOUND, /* The input parameter(s) specified a particular item which was not found */
60 M64ERR_NO_MEMORY, /* Memory allocation failed */
61 M64ERR_FILES, /* Error opening, creating, reading, or writing to a file */
62 M64ERR_INTERNAL, /* Internal error (bug) */
63 M64ERR_INVALID_STATE, /* Current program state does not allow operation */
64 M64ERR_PLUGIN_FAIL, /* A plugin function returned a fatal error */
65 M64ERR_SYSTEM_FAIL, /* A system function call, such as an SDL or file operation, failed */
66 M64ERR_UNSUPPORTED, /* Function call is not supported (ie, core not built with debugger) */
67 M64ERR_WRONG_TYPE /* A given input type parameter cannot be used for desired operation */
68 } m64p_error;

153 } m64p_system_type;
154
155 typedef struct
156 {
157 unsigned char init_PI_BSB_DOM1_LAT_REG; /* 0x00 */
158 unsigned char init_PI_BSB_DOM1_PGS_REG; /* 0x01 */
159 unsigned char init_PI_BSB_DOM1_PWD_REG; /* 0x02 */
160 unsigned char init_PI_BSB_DOM1_PGS_REG2; /* 0x03 */
161 unsigned int ClockRate; /* 0x04 */
162 unsigned int PC; /* 0x08 */
163 unsigned int Release; /* 0x0C */
164 unsigned int CRC1; /* 0x10 */
165 unsigned int CRC2; /* 0x14 */
166 unsigned int Unknown[2]; /* 0x18 */
167 unsigned char Name[20]; /* 0x20 */
168 unsigned int unknown; /* 0x34 */
169 unsigned int Manufacturer_ID; /* 0x38 */
170 unsigned short Cartridge_ID; /* 0x3C - Game serial number */
171 unsigned short Country_code; /* 0x3E */
172 } m64p_rom_header;
173
174 typedef struct
175 {
176 char goodname[256];
177 char MD5[33];
178 unsigned char savetype;
179 unsigned char status; /* Rom status on a scale from 0-5. */
180 unsigned char players; /* Local players 0-4, 2/3/4 way Netplay indicated by 5/6/7. */
181 unsigned char rumble; /* 0 - No, 1 - Yes boolean for rumble support. */
182 } m64p_rom_settings;
